void QLocalSocket::connectToServer(OpenMode openMode)
{
    Q_D(QLocalSocket);
    if (state() == ConnectedState || state() == ConnectingState) {
        d->error = OperationError;
        d->errorString = tr("Trying to connect while connection is in progress");
        emit error(QLocalSocket::OperationError);
        return;
    }

    d->error = QLocalSocket::UnknownSocketError;
    d->errorString = QString();
    d->state = ConnectingState;
    emit stateChanged(d->state);
    if (d->serverName.isEmpty()) {
        d->error = ServerNotFoundError;
        d->errorString = tr("%1: Invalid name").arg(QLatin1String("QLocalSocket::connectToServer"));
        d->state = UnconnectedState;
        emit error(d->error);
        emit stateChanged(d->state);
        return;
    }

    const QLatin1String pipePath("\\\\.\\pipe\\");
    if (d->serverName.startsWith(pipePath))
        d->fullServerName = d->serverName;
    else
        d->fullServerName = pipePath + d->serverName;
    // Try to open a named pipe
    HANDLE localSocket;
    forever {
        DWORD permissions = (openMode & QIODevice::ReadOnly) ? GENERIC_READ : 0;
        permissions |= (openMode & QIODevice::WriteOnly) ? GENERIC_WRITE : 0;
        localSocket = CreateFile(reinterpret_cast<const wchar_t *>(d->fullServerName.utf16()), // pipe name
                                 permissions,
                                 0,              // no sharing
                                 NULL,           // default security attributes
                                 OPEN_EXISTING,  // opens existing pipe
                                 FILE_FLAG_OVERLAPPED,
                                 NULL);          // no template file

        if (localSocket != INVALID_HANDLE_VALUE)
            break;
        DWORD error = GetLastError();
        // It is really an error only if it is not ERROR_PIPE_BUSY
        if (ERROR_PIPE_BUSY != error) {
            break;
        }

        // All pipe instances are busy, so wait until connected or up to 5 seconds.
        if (!WaitNamedPipe((const wchar_t *)d->fullServerName.utf16(), 5000))
            break;
    }

    if (localSocket == INVALID_HANDLE_VALUE) {
        const DWORD winError = GetLastError();
        d->_q_winError(winError, QLatin1String("QLocalSocket::connectToServer"));
        d->fullServerName = QString();
        return;
    }

    // we have a valid handle
    if (setSocketDescriptor(reinterpret_cast<qintptr>(localSocket), ConnectedState, openMode))
        emit connected();
}

void QLocalSocket::disconnectFromServer()
{
    Q_D(QLocalSocket);

    // Are we still connected?
    if (!isValid()) {
        // If we have unwritten data, the pipeWriter is still present.
        // It must be destroyed before close() to prevent an infinite loop.
        delete d->pipeWriter;
        d->pipeWriter = 0;
        d->writeBuffer.clear();
    }

    flush();
    if (bytesToWrite() != 0) {
        d->state = QLocalSocket::ClosingState;
        emit stateChanged(d->state);
    } else {
        close();
    }
}
